The median sold price in Trinity Road is £120,000, based on 117 sales recorded by HM Land Registry.
Over the past decade prices in Trinity Road are +44% in cash terms, and +2% after adjusting for inflation (ONS CPIH).
The median is £1,467 per square metre, from EPC floor-area records.
Figures update monthly from HM Land Registry. The most recent sale here was recorded on 12 November 2025; the latest two months may be incomplete while sales register.
